The Cultural Studies and Media (Hons) programme at University of Kent is an innovative subject exploring the complexity of contemporary media and culture in our rapidly changing global society. The degree offers an academically rigorous approach to the study of mediated cultural forms, practices and technologies and their vital social, political and economic implications.

Course programme

Course Content Course structure Stage 1Possible modules may include:
  • Contemporary Culture and Media
  • Sociology of Everyday Life
  • Fundamentals of Sociology
  • Sociological Theory: The Classics
You have the opportunity to select wild modules in this stageStage 2Possible modules may include:
  • Popular Culture, Media and Society
  • Environmental Politics
  • Mental Health
  • Violence and Society
  • Criminal Justice in Modern Britain:Development, Issues and Politics
